本文為英文版的機器翻譯版本,如內容有任何歧義或不一致之處,概以英文版為準。
WordPress 在 Lightsail 上啟動和設定
透過這份快速入門指南,您將了解如何在 Amazon Lightsail 上啟動和設定 WordPress 執行個體。
步驟 1:建立 WordPress執行個體
完成下列步驟,讓您的 WordPress 執行個體啟動並執行。
若要建立以下項 Lightsail 的實體 WordPress
-
登入主 Li ghtsail 台
。 -
在 Lightsail 首頁的「實體」區段中,選擇「建立實體」。
-
為您的執行個體選擇 AWS 區域 和可用區域。
-
選擇執行個體的映像檔,如下所示:
-
針對 [選取平台],選擇 [Linu x/Unix]。
-
對於選取藍圖,請選擇WordPress。
-
-
選擇執行個體方案。
計劃包括以低廉且可預測的成本的機器配置(RAM,SSD,vCPU)以及數據傳輸額度。
-
輸入您執行個體的名稱。資源名稱:
-
每個 Lightsail 帳戶 AWS 區域 中的每個項目都必須是唯一的。
-
必須包含 2 至 255 個字元。
-
開頭和結尾必須是英數字元或數字。
-
可以包含英數字元、數字、句點、破折號和底線。
-
-
選擇 建立執行個體。
-
若要檢視測試部落格文章,請前往執行個體管理頁面,複製頁面右上角顯示的公用 IPv4 位址。將位址貼到連線至網際網路之網頁瀏覽器的位址欄位中。瀏覽器會顯示測試部落格文章。
步驟 2:設定您的 WordPress執行個體
您可以使用可設定下列 WordPress 項目的引導式 step-by-step 工作流程來設定執行個體:
-
已註冊的網域名稱 — 您的 WordPress 網站需要一個容易記住的網域名稱。使用者將指定此網域名稱來存取您的 WordPress 網站。如需詳細資訊,請參閱 為您的網站註冊和管理 Lightsail。
-
DNS 管理 — 您必須決定如何管理網域的 DNS 記錄。DNS 記錄會告訴 DNS 伺服器與網域或子網域相關聯的 IP 位址或主機名稱。DNS 區域包含您網域的 DNS 記錄。如需詳細資訊,請參閱 了解 DNS Lightsail。
-
靜態 IP 位址 — 如果您停止並啟動執行個體, WordPress 執行個體的預設公用 IP 位址就會變更。當您將靜態 IP 位址附加到執行個體時,即使您停止並啟動執行個體,它仍會保持不變。如需詳細資訊,請參閱 檢視和管理資源的 Lightsail 址。
-
SSL/TLS 憑證 — 建立驗證憑證並將其安裝在執行個體上之後,您可以為網站啟用 HTTPS,以便透過註冊 WordPress 網域路由傳送至執行個體的流量會使用 HTTPS 加密。如需詳細資訊,請參閱 使用 HTTPS 保護您 WordPress 的 Lightsail。
提示
開始之前,請先檢閱下列秘訣。如需疑難排解的資訊,請參閱疑 WordPress 難排解
-
安裝程式支援在 2023 年 1 月 1 日之後建立的 WordPress 版本 6 及更新版本的 Lightsail 執行個體。
-
在安裝期間執行的 Certbot 相依性檔案、HTTPS 重新寫入指令碼和憑證更新指令碼會儲存在執行個體的
/opt/bitnami/lightsail/scripts/
目錄中。 -
您的執行個體必須處於執行中狀態。如果執行個體剛啟動,請等待幾分鐘的時間讓 SSH 連線準備就緒。
-
執行個體防火牆上的連接埠 22、80 和 443 必須允許在安裝程式執行時從任何 IP 位址進行 TCP 連線。如需詳細資訊,請參閱執行個體防火牆。
-
當您新增或更新指向來自頂點網域 (
example.com
) 及其www
子網域 (www.example.com
) 流量的 DNS 記錄時,這些記錄必須在整個網際網路中傳播。您可以驗證您的 DNS 更改已經通過使用工具生效, 或 DNS查 找從. MxToolbox -
在 2023 年 1 月 1 日之前創建的 WordPress 實例可能包含一個不推薦使用的 Certbot 個人 Package 存檔(PPA)存儲庫,這將導致網站設置失敗。如果此儲存庫在安裝期間存在,它將從現有路徑中移除,並備份到執行個體上的下列位置:
~/opt/bitnami/lightsail/repo.backup
有關已過時 PPA 的更多信息,請參閱規範網站上的 Certbot PPA。 -
讓我們加密證書將每 60 到 90 天自動續訂一次。
-
進行安裝程序時,請勿停止或變更執行個體。設定執行個體最多可能需要 15 分鐘的時間。您可以在執行個體連線索引標籤中檢視每個步驟的進度。
使用網站設定精靈設定執行個體
-
在執行個體管理頁面的 [Connect] 索引標籤上,選擇 [設定您的網站]。
-
針對「指定網域名稱」,請使用現有的 Lightsail 受管理網域、向 Lightsail 註冊新網域,或使用您透過其他網域註冊機構註冊的網域。選擇 [使用此網域] 以前往下一個步驟。
-
對於設定 DNS,請執行下列其中一個動作:
-
選擇受管理的網域以使用 Lightsail DNS 區域。選擇 [使用此 DNS 區域] 以前往下一個步驟。
-
選擇第三方網域以使用管理您網域 DNS 記錄的主機服務。請注意,如果您稍後決定使用,我們會在您的 Lightsail 帳戶中建立相符的 DNS 區域。選擇「使用第三方 DNS」以進行下一步。
-
-
在 [建立靜態 IP 位址] 中,輸入靜態 IP 位址的名稱,然後選擇 [建立靜態 IP]。
-
針對 [管理網域指派],選擇 [新增指派],選擇網域類型,然後選擇 [新增]。選擇「繼續」以前往下一個步驟。
-
在「建立 SSL/TLS 憑證」中,選擇您的網域和子網域、輸入電子郵件地址、選取「我授權 Lightsail 在我的執行個體上設定讓我們加密憑證」,然後選擇「建立憑證」。我們開始設定 Lightsail 資源。
進行安裝程序時,請勿停止或變更執行個體。設定執行個體最多可能需要 15 分鐘的時間。您可以在執行個體連線索引標籤中檢視每個步驟的進度。
-
網站設定完成後,請確認您在網域指派步驟中指定的 URL 是否開啟您的網 WordPress 站。
步驟 3:獲取您 WordPress 網站的默認應用程序密碼
您需要預設的應用程式密碼才能登入 WordPress 網站的管理儀表板。
取得 WordPress 管理員的預設密碼
-
開啟執行個體的執行 WordPress 個體管理頁面。
-
在WordPress面板上,選擇「擷取預設密碼」。這會展開頁面底部的存取預設密碼。
-
選擇 [啟動] CloudShell。這將在頁面底部打開一個面板。
-
選擇「複製」,然後將內容貼到 CloudShell 視窗中。您可以將光標放在 CloudShell 提示符處並按 Ctrl+V,也可以右鍵單擊以打開菜單,然後選擇粘貼。
-
記下 CloudShell 視窗中顯示的密碼。您需要此功能才能登入 WordPress 網站的管理儀表板。
步驟 4:登入您的 WordPress網站
現在您擁有預設的使用者密碼,請瀏覽至 WordPress 網站的首頁,然後登入管理儀表板。登入之後,您可以變更預設密碼。
若要登入管理儀表板
-
開啟執行個體的執行 WordPress 個體管理頁面。
-
在WordPress面板上,選擇 [存取 WordPress 管理員]。
-
在 [存取您的 WordPress 管理儀表板] 面板的 [使用公用 IP 位址] 下方,選擇具有此格式的連結:
HTTP://
公共 IPV4
地址。 /WP-管理員 -
針對使用者名稱或電子郵件地址,輸入
user
-
在「密碼」中,輸入在上一個步驟中取得的密碼。
-
選擇 Log in (登入)。
您現在已登入 WordPress 網站的管理儀表板,您可以在其中執行管理動作。有關管理 WordPress 網站的更多信息,請參閱文檔中的 WordPress WordPress Codex
。
步驟 5:閱讀 Bitnami 文件
閱讀 Bitnami 文檔以了解如何在您的 WordPress 網站上執行管理任務,例如安裝插件,自定義主題以及升級您的版本。 WordPress
如需詳細資訊,請參 WordPress